I hope my question is not too far off topic. We are planning a backpacking trip out of Horseshoe Meadow down to Tunnel Meadow then north again to Big Whitney Meadow, Siberian Pass and New Army Pass and back to HSM. I am wondering what kind of water situation we could expect. Is there a reasonable chance for good fishing in mid July (16 to 20). Last time I was in the area it was very dry. That was in September though.

Kurt,
Water should be no problem. Streams should within a reasonable didtance of all trails. Fishing should also be good between Tunnel Meadow and Big Whitney Meadow.
